Instructions
Select fresh or refrigerated tortellini and prepare it according to package guidelines, ensuring a perfectly tender al dente texture. Carefully drain the pasta in a colander, allowing excess water to escape.
Position a spacious skillet over medium flame and melt butter until it transforms into a golden, aromatic liquid. Introduce finely chopped garlic and sauté briefly, releasing its intense fragrance throughout the kitchen.
Stream heavy cream into the skillet, whisking continuously to create a harmonious blend that promises a silky foundation for the impending sauce.
As the liquid begins to bubble gently, incorporate Parmesan cheese, blending in garlic powder, onion powder, and freshly ground black pepper. Maintain vigorous whisking to develop a luxuriously smooth consistency.
Lower the heat, allowing the sauce to simmer and gradually thicken, developing a rich, velvety texture that clings effortlessly to the pasta.
Gently fold the cooked tortellini into the creamy sauce, ensuring each pasta pocket becomes completely enrobed in the decadent Alfredo coating.
Transfer the tortellini to serving plates, presenting a final flourish of freshly grated Parmesan cheese and delicately chopped parsley to elevate both visual appeal and flavor profile.
